Core Architecture and Storage Mechanics

At its foundation, Google Drive operates on a distributed file system designed for high reliability and accessibility. The platform provides users with 15GB of free storage, shared across Gmail and Google Photos, which serves as an entry point for personal use. For professional environments, tiered subscription plans unlock advanced features like enhanced security controls, larger data allowances, and priority server access. This scalable architecture ensures that whether managing a single document or a vast repository of enterprise data, the infrastructure adapts to demand without compromising performance.

Integrated Collaboration and Real-Time Editing

Simultaneous Multi-User Interaction

The true power of Google Drive info lies in its real-time collaboration capabilities. Documents, spreadsheets, and presentations can be edited simultaneously by multiple team members, with changes reflected instantly across all screens. This functionality eliminates the friction of version control and email attachments, streamlining workflows significantly. Integrated commenting and suggestion modes further facilitate feedback, creating a dynamic environment where ideas develop iteratively and transparently.

Security Protocols and Administrative Controls

Security is paramount for any cloud storage solution, and Google Drive implements enterprise-grade measures to protect user data. Information is encrypted during transit using TLS and while at rest with AES-256 encryption, ensuring that sensitive files remain secure. Administrators benefit from detailed dashboards that allow for granular permission settings, device management, and the implementation of two-factor authentication. These controls are vital for maintaining compliance with data protection regulations and safeguarding intellectual property.

Advanced Features and Third-Party Integration

Beyond basic storage, the platform’s strength is amplified through integration with the Google Workspace suite and external applications. Tools like Google Docs, Sheets, and Slides are natively supported, allowing for immediate creation and editing directly within the Drive interface. Furthermore, the marketplace supports thousands of third-party apps, connecting Drive to project management, CRM, and design tools. This interoperability transforms Drive from a simple repository into a command center for productivity, centralizing access to critical resources.

File Organization and Search Efficiency

Effective management of digital assets requires a logical structure, and Google Drive provides multiple layers of organization. Users can create a hierarchy of folders and leverage powerful search functions to locate files based on content, document type, or modification date. The integration of AI-driven features, such as suggested files and image recognition, enhances the search experience by identifying text within images or extracting keywords from documents. This ensures that critical information is never buried, significantly reducing time spent navigating complex directories.

Practical Considerations for Implementation

When adopting Google Drive for professional use, several practical factors influence success. Bandwidth consumption can be significant for large teams frequently uploading high-resolution media, necessitating a stable internet connection. Offline access is available through dedicated sync clients, ensuring continuity in environments with limited connectivity. Regular audits of storage usage and shared link permissions are recommended to maintain optimal performance and prevent unauthorized access, preserving the integrity of the stored information.
